Furthermore, Rovigon, as a balanced association between vitamins A and E, is indicated in functional disorders and degenerative manifestations of tissues of epithelial and mesodermal origin (for example degenerative retinopathies, inner ear disorders, etc.), especially in middle-aged and elderly people.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e \u003cb\u003eWhat you need to know before taking the medicine\u003c\/b\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Hypersensitivity to the active substance or to any of the excipients.\u003cbr\u003e Hypervitaminosis A.\u003cbr\u003e Children under 12 years of age.\u003cbr\u003e Women who are pregnant or may become pregnant.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e \u003cb\u003eWarnings and precautions\u003c\/b\u003e\u003cbr\u003e In order to avoid the appearance of signs and symptoms of overdose, use the product under medical supervision and for the period of time deemed strictly necessary. \u003cbr\u003ePreparations containing Vitamin E should be used with caution in diabetics and patients with heart failure since this vitamin may reduce the need for insulin and digitalis.\u003cbr\u003e In very prolonged therapies, especially if for several years, do not exceed the number and duration of therapeutic cycles recommended for each year, in order to avoid the risk of chronic overdose of vitamin A.\u003cbr\u003e In patients who smoke twenty or more cigarettes a day, prolonged use of the product may increase the risk of developing lung cancer.\u003cbr\u003e During pregnancy, a daily intake of vitamin A up to 10,000 IU has been shown to be safe.\u003cbr\u003e However, doses higher than 15,000 IU\/day have been associated with the possibility of malformations in humans. Therefore, during pregnancy, daily doses higher than 10,000 IU should be avoided, especially during the first trimester (see also “Pregnancy and breastfeeding”). \u003cbr\u003eVitamin A should not be taken together with other drugs containing vitamin A, the synthetic isomers tretinoin and etretinate or beta-carotene, since these compounds, in high doses, are considered harmful to the fetus.\u003cbr\u003e In women of childbearing age it is necessary to ensure that:\u003cbr\u003e • the patient is not pregnant when starting treatment (negative pregnancy test)\u003cbr\u003e • the patient understands the teratogenic risk\u003cbr\u003e • the patient agrees to use an effective method of contraception without interruption for the entire duration of treatment and for at least one month after its cessation.\u003cbr\u003e Long-term treatment with vitamin A has been associated with cirrhosis, impaired hepatic circulation, hepatic fibrosis, and hepatotoxicity. Patients with pre-existing liver disease are at increased risk of developing or worsening liver disease due to reduced ability to produce retinol-binding protein. \u003cbr\u003ePatients taking high doses of vitamin A (greater than 2,500 IU\/kg per day) for a prolonged period without interruption should be monitored for signs of hypervitaminosis A.\u003cbr\u003e A maximum daily dose of 5,000 IU\/kg must not be exceeded.\u003cbr\u003e Before prescribing treatment, the intake of vitamin A, isotretinoin, etretinate and beta-carotene from diet and any use of supplements and concomitant medications should be assessed.\u003cbr\u003e High doses of vitamin A have been associated with osteoporosis and osteosclerosis.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e \u003cb\u003ePossible side effects\u003c\/b\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Like all medicines, Rovigon can cause side effects, although not everybody gets them.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e The following side effects have been reported in association with the use of Rovigon.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eEye pathologies\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Visual disturbances.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eGastrointestinal disorders\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Gastrointestinal and ab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, diarrhea.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eHepatobiliary pathologies\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Jaundice, hepatomegaly, hepatic steatosis. \u003cbr\u003eCirrhosis, hepatic fibrosis, and hepatotoxicity have been associated with long-term vitamin A therapy (See “Warnings”).\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eImmune system disorders\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Allergic reaction, allergic edema, anaphylactic reaction, anaphylactic shock.\u003cbr\u003e Hypersensitivity reactions and their clinical and laboratory manifestations include mild to moderate reactions that may involve the skin, respiratory tract, gastrointestinal tract and cardiovascular system. \u003cem\u003eDiagnostic tests\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Abnormal liver function tests, increased aspartate and alanine aminotransferase, increased blood triglycerides.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eMetabolism and nutrition disorders\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Hypercalcemia, lipid metabolism disorder.\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eMusculoskeletal and connective tissue disorders\u003c\/em\u003e Bone pain and osteoporosis; high intake of vitamin A through diet or supplements has been associated with increased osteoporosis and risk of hip fracture. \u003cbr\u003e\u003cem\u003eNervous system disorders\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Headache. Sudden onset of headache may be one of the symptoms of pseudotumor cerebri (see “Overdose”).\u003cbr\u003e \u003cem\u003eSkin and subcutaneous tissue disorders\u003c\/em\u003e\u003cbr\u003e Itching, urticaria, rash, dry skin, exfoliative dermatitis.\u003cbr\u003e Chronic use of vitamin A has been associated with: alopecia, dermatitis, eczema, erythema, skin discoloration, hair structure changes, hypotrichosis, dry mucous membranes, skin fragility, cheilitis.
